    Many trails around. N202 runs between Pioneertown and Big Bear and is a favorite, several trails out by the dry lakebed in Joshua Tree (BLM land mostly, massive solar farm on it now, Sunfair Rd/ Broadway will get you out to it, Geology Tour Rd in JT Park, good hiking out there too, old mines, 18 miles, 4x4 or at least good clearance recommended after first 3 miles. I'm not the best with all the trail names but there are a lot of cool, quirky areas that don't necessarily need 4x4, Giant Rock that is a couple miles in the dirt from The Integratron (built by an eccentric engineer with plans given by aliens, offers sound baths on weekends, pretty cool to do at least once), Pappy n Harriet's in Pioneertown for awesome food and cold beverages, old town behind it where some westerns were filmed, do a wild West show in summer, Johnson Valley OHV, King of the Hammers will be here in Feb, killer tricked out race trucks, thousands turn out for it, some trails that Renegades can get on out there to explore. Pretty easy to find all kinds of little areas out here to spend a day wheeling.

    Oh nice, you're just down the road from me! I've only done Cleghorn and Hungry Valley, but both are awesome for a Renegade. Cleghorn has some really technical stuff, but you can go around anything you're not comfortable with. I think there were only 2 obstacles I couldn't handle. One of them was more of an alternate trail near the end. Not too bummed about that one though, even my friend's Wrangler had major issues with it. Took well over an hour to get through what was probably less than half a mile. But that's including the time it took to jack it up to put a spring back on that popped out. It popped out again farther down that section, but he just left it off since the second time he was almost through it and put it back on at the bottom.
